Finding the right hairstyle after 50 can be a game-changer for your daily routine. As we age, our hair texture changes and we have less time for complicated styling routines. Let’s explore ten easy-to-maintain cuts that will keep you looking fabulous with minimal effort, plus five styles that require too much upkeep to be practical.

1. Corte Pixie clássico

Elegant and timeless, the pixie cut requires just minutes to style each morning. Simply apply a small amount of lightweight styling cream, run your fingers through for texture, and you’re ready to conquer the day! No more hours spent blow-drying or curling.

2. Bob com camadas

Bobs never go out of style, especially when customized with face-framing layers. The beauty lies in its versatility – air dry for a casual look or quickly blow-dry for more polish. Movement and volume come naturally with this cut.

3. Soft Shag with Curtain Bangs

Shaggy cuts with franja de cortina offer that rock-and-roll edge while remaining age-appropriate. The layers create natural volume even without styling tools.

Wake up, shake your head, apply a texturizing spray, and you’re good to go!

4. Blunt Lob (Long Bob)

The lob hits that sweet spot between short and long, offering flexibility without the maintenance. Its blunt ends create the illusion of thickness – perfect for thinning hair that comes with age. Simply straighten or add gentle waves depending on your mood.

5. Corte com textura

Shorter than a pixie but not quite a buzz cut, the textured crop exudes confidence and sophistication. Gray hair looks particularly striking in this style! Just use a dab of pomade to define the pieces and add dimension.

6. Modern Shoulder-Length Cut

A shoulder-grazing cut with subtle layers offers the perfect balance of style and manageability. The length allows for ponytails on busy days while still looking polished when worn down.

Minimal styling keeps this look fresh and youthful.

7. Soft Pixie-Bob Hybrid

Longer than a pixie but shorter than a bob, this hybrid style offers the best of both worlds. The nape stays short for coolness while the top remains long enough to style. Perfect for active women who want options without fuss.

8. Tousled Waves with Face-Framing Layers

Embrace your natural texture with this cut designed for air-drying. The magic happens with strategic layers that encourage waves to form naturally.

Just scrunch in some mousse while damp and let nature do the styling work!

9. Chin-Length French Bob

Channel your inner Parisian with this chic, jaw-skimming cut. The Bob francês requires minimal styling yet always looks intentional and put-together. Straight or wavy, this cut maintains its shape beautifully between salon visits.

10. Tapered Pixie with Long Crown

This modern take on the pixie keeps length on top while tapering the sides and back. The versatile style can be sleek for work or tousled for weekends.

A quick blow-dry with a round brush creates instant volume where you need it most.

11. Super Long Straight Hair

While stunning on some, waist-length hair demands significant upkeep after 50. The daily conditioning, detangling, and drying can consume hours weekly. Plus, very long hair often looks thinner due to weight pulling down on aging follicles.

12. Elaborate Updo Styles

Unless you’re attending special events regularly, complicated updos requiring dozens of pins and products aren’t practical daily options. The strain on your arms while styling can be particularly uncomfortable. Most importantly, tight styles can stress already fragile hair.

13. High-Maintenance Layered Cuts

Razor-thin layers might look amazing initially but grow out unevenly and require frequent trims. These cuts often need precise blow-drying with multiple brushes and products to recreate the salon look.

Without daily styling, they quickly lose their shape and appeal.

14. Blunt Heavy Bangs

Thick, straight-across bangs require daily styling and frequent trims to maintain their precise line. They also tend to separate with natural oils and can look dated without proper maintenance. The growing-out phase is particularly awkward, with limited styling options.

15. Overly Processed Platinum Blonde

The double-process bleaching required for loiro platinado severely weakens aging hair. The 3-4 week root touch-ups become increasingly expensive and time-consuming. Harsh chemicals can lead to breakage and thinning – the opposite of what most women over 50 want!
